Exploring Humanity: What Makes Us Human? A Journey through Key Questions

What exactly are we? The modern world has many answers to that question, each of which has consequences for the choices we make about our own life and the lives of others.

In this short, accessible book, Mark Meynell wants to help confused Christians understand what God has said in the scriptures about key questions, such as when does life begin, where do our souls come from, and what sets humans apart?

He offers a positive and liberating way forward as we discover what true humanity really is.
